Obit Barbara J. MigliozziWestborough – Barbara J. Migliozzi, 89, passed away Wednesday, July 13, 2016 at UMass Memorial Hospital, with her loving family at her side. She was the daughter of the late Anthony and Lucy (Swift) Kleczka. She was predeceased by the love of her life, Hank Migliozzi, and her son, Richard B. Migliozzi.

She is survived by her sons, Mark S. Migliozzi and his wife Dianna of Westborough and David P. Migliozzi and his wife Tammy of Wesley Chapel, Fla.; her granddaughter, Sara J. Migliozzi of Virginia Beach, Va.; her grandsons, Andrew J. Migliozzi and his fiancée Rae Lynn Chambers of Mooresville, N.C. and Anthony J. Migliozzi, his wife Jill, and her great-granddaughter Della of Northborough; her sister, Elizabeth A. Lapierre of Greenfield; and her sister-in-law, Jean Danckert of Statesville, N.C. She was predeceased by her brother, Donald Kleczka and his wife Corrine; sister-in-law, Della Gordon; and brothers-in-law, Ralph Migliozzi, Norman Lapierre, and John Danckert.

Barbara was born in Worcester and educated in the Worcester school system, graduating from South High School in 1945. She entered the Memorial Hospital School of Nursing, graduating as an RN in 1948.

She worked for many years at the Memorial Hospital in Worcester. She began her career in the Emergency Ward and retired as the head nurse of the Coronary Intensive Care Unit.

Barbara loved Cape Cod and spent many family vacations at their home in Eastham. In retirement, Barbara and Hank enjoyed traveling in their RV, visiting all 50 states and every province in Canada. They also spent two summers in Alaska. In their later years, they would spend summers in Massachusetts and winters in Nokomis, Fla.

Barbara cherished her time with her family. She was an avid reader and loved working in her gardens and on various crafts.
